اطلاعیه

Collapse
No announcement yet.

انتقال از arduino به avr

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    انتقال از arduino به avr

    سلام
    من یه مدار با آردوینو ساختم و می خواستم بدونم اگه کد های arduino ide رو به هگز تبدیل کنم و رو میکروکنترلر پروگرمش کنم، مدارم کار می کنه؟
    یه سوال دیگه: من pcb رو طراحی کردم الان اینو باید چجوری چاپ کنم؟ آیا دستگاه مخصوصی داره یا...؟

    #2
    پاسخ : انتقال از arduino به avr

    سلام
    اره هگزش رو بریزی رومیکروکنترلر مشابه همونی که روی برد اردوینوت هست موردی نداره و کار می کنه.
    فیبر رو هم اگر تک لایه هست می تونی دستی چاپ کنی و یا بدی شرکت های چا فیبر.
    چرا ناراحتی پاتریک!
    + امروز ی بچه دیدم سرچهارراه گل میفروخت
    - از دیدنش ناراحت شدی؟
    + نه
    پس چی ناراحتت کرده
    + اینکه دیدن اینجور بچه ها انقدر واسم عادی شده که دیگه ناراحتم نمیکنه
    ------------------------------------------------------------------------------------------------------
    تاحالا فکر کردی بیسواد کیه؟- بی سواد یعنی کسی که نمیتونه ذهنیاتش رو عملی کنه!
    ------------------------------------------------------------------------------------------------------
    محصولات

    دیدگاه


      #3
      پاسخ : انتقال از arduino به avr

      نوشته اصلی توسط alone123 نمایش پست ها
      سلام
      من یه مدار با آردوینو ساختم و می خواستم بدونم اگه کد های arduino ide رو به هگز تبدیل کنم و رو میکروکنترلر پروگرمش کنم، مدارم کار می کنه؟
      یه سوال دیگه: من pcb رو طراحی کردم الان اینو باید چجوری چاپ کنم؟ آیا دستگاه مخصوصی داره یا...؟
      سلام دوست گرامی
      فقط فایل هگز کافی نیست بلکه باید فیوز بیت ها رو هم مطابق فیوز بیت های آردینو تنظیم کنی تا برنامت دقیقا مثل آردینو ران بشه
      به بوت لودر هم نیازی نیست...
      ! Life doesn't get easier , you just get stronger

      دیدگاه


        #4
        پاسخ : انتقال از arduino به avr

        نوشته اصلی توسط Blue Ice نمایش پست ها
        سلام دوست گرامی
        فقط فایل هگز کافی نیست بلکه باید فیوز بیت ها رو هم مطابق فیوز بیت های آردینو تنظیم کنی تا برنامت دقیقا مثل آردینو ران بشه
        به بوت لودر هم نیازی نیست...
        میشه بگین چطور باید فیوز بیت ها رو تنظیم کنم؟
        مدل آردوینو ی من Uno هست:

        و میکروم ATmega8A هست.

        دیدگاه


          #5
          پاسخ : انتقال از arduino به avr

          فرض را بر این می گذاریم که می خواهیم مقادیر Fuse Bit مناسب برای ATmega328 نرع DIP را پیدا کنیم.
          آردوینو به صورت پیش فرض تعدادی Fuse Bit دارد که اگر نرم افزار را در مسیر پیش فرض نصب کرده باشیم فهرست این Fuse Bitها به تفکیک هر آردوینو در مسیر C:\Program Files\Arduino\hardware\arduino\avr\boards.txt موجود است.
          پرونده ی boards.txt را با نرم افزاری مثل ++Notepad باز کنیم تعدادی خط منظم می بینیم که در بخشی نوشته شده است uno.name=Arduino/Genuino Uno و در زیر آن چندین خط نوشته شده است که بخشی از آن برای پی بردن به Fuse Bit ها استفاده می شود.
          ! Life doesn't get easier , you just get stronger

          دیدگاه


            #6
            پاسخ : انتقال از arduino به avr

            نوشته اصلی توسط Blue Ice نمایش پست ها
            فرض را بر این می گذاریم که می خواهیم مقادیر Fuse Bit مناسب برای ATmega328 نرع DIP را پیدا کنیم.
            آردوینو به صورت پیش فرض تعدادی Fuse Bit دارد که اگر نرم افزار را در مسیر پیش فرض نصب کرده باشیم فهرست این Fuse Bitها به تفکیک هر آردوینو در مسیر C:\Program Files\Arduino\hardware\arduino\avr\boards.txt موجود است.
            پرونده ی boards.txt را با نرم افزاری مثل ++Notepad باز کنیم تعدادی خط منظم می بینیم که در بخشی نوشته شده است uno.name=Arduino/Genuino Uno و در زیر آن چندین خط نوشته شده است که بخشی از آن برای پی بردن به Fuse Bit ها استفاده می شود.

            الان باید کدوم بخش ها مهمن؟
            چطوری باید تو armega8 اینا رو تنظیم کنم؟

            دیدگاه


              #7
              پاسخ : انتقال از arduino به avr

              شما برنامه آردو روی uno که مگا۳۲۸ هست رو که نمیتونید روی مگا۸ بریزید ،
              هدف از این کار چیه ؟ اگر سایز برد بزرگه از اردو پرو مینی استفاده کنید ،
              یا اینکه باید از میکرو مگا۳۲۸ به جای مگا۸ استفاده کنید .

              راه داره که روی آردو مگا۸ هم بتونید پروگرام کنید که یکم پیچیده ست و امکانات کمتری داره توصیه نمیشه .

              دیدگاه


                #8
                پاسخ : انتقال از arduino به avr

                یه سوال چه طوری کد های arduino رو به c تبدیل کنم

                دیدگاه


                  #9
                  پاسخ : انتقال از arduino به avr

                  نوشته اصلی توسط H.T_sh نمایش پست ها
                  یه سوال چه طوری کد های arduino رو به c تبدیل کنم
                  نمیخواد تبدیل کنی.اردینو به زبان سی هست.البته اردینو به زبان جاوا هست.جاوا هم همن زبان سی هست.حالا یه سری مفاهیم مثل شی و کپسول بهش اضافه شده.در تعریف کلی برنامه فریق نمی کنه.
                  eshop-hodhod.ir

                  دیدگاه

                  لطفا صبر کنید...
                  X